Computer Skills 2

QuestionAnswer
Hyperlink a word, phrase, or image that you can click on to jump to a new document or a new section within the current document
Link When you are browsing the Web and you see a highlighted and underlined word or phrase on a page, there is a good chance you are looking at this
Web page an individual HTML document
Website a collection of Web pages
HTML This is the language that Web pages are written in
HTTP This is the protocol used to transfer data over the World Wide Web or also called "HyperText Transport Protocol"
HTTPS "HyperText Transport Protocol Secure."
Serial Port a type of connection on PCs that is used for peripherals such as mice
Parallel Port This interface is found on the back of older PCs and is used for connecting external devices such as printers or a scanners
USB Port Stands for "Universal Serial Bus."
Webmaster the person in charge of maintaining a Web site
Domain Name This is the name that identifies an Web site
Domain Suffix is the last part of a domain name and is often referred to as a "top-level domain" or TLD
Encryption The coding or scrambling of information so that it can only be decoded and read by someone who has the correct decoding key
Log In / Log On If you are ever asked to enter your username and password, you are being asked to enter your
Log Off / Log Out refers to the process of accessing a secure computer system or website and disconnects you from a server
Cookie a small amount of data generated by a website and saved by your web browser.
Screen Shot picture taken of your computer's desktop. This may include the desktop background, icons of files and folders, and open windows.
Upload sending a file from your computer to another system.
Download This is the process in which data is sent to your computer.
Auto fill Cursor This cursor looks like a thin black cross and this cursor will let you repeat things or in a series
Select Mode Cursor This cursor looks like a thick cross if you are in excel and this shows you are in normal mode
Click and Drag Cursor This cursor looks like a white arrow with a black outline and if you move this it will move where ever you have your mouse
Resizing Cursor This cursor looks like a thick black line with two arrows intersecting it and this cursor is used to change the size of your columns and rows
